
Macstar Group Joint Stock Company (MAC), formerly known as 123 Transport Mechanical Enterprise, was established in 1984. In 2003, the company transformed its operating model in the form of a joint stock company with a charter capital of VND 4 billion, of which the capital contribution of the Maritime Corporation (representing State capital) was VND 1.2 billion (30%) and the rest of the shareholders were employees. Up to now, the charter capital of the company is 151.39 billion VND. The main business of the company is to provide maritime services such as supply, repair, import and export of ship equipment and seaports. Regarding production and installation of suspension equipment (GOH): The company has always maintained its leading position in market share in Vietnam and Cambodia. Through cooperation with Golstar Marine partners, the Company has directly contacted and introduced products and services directly to major retailers such as Primark, Mango. On December 24, 2009, MAC officially traded on the Hanoi Stock Exchange (HNX).
MAC currently has a market capitalization of roughly VND 542 billion, placing it in the small-cap group on the Vietnamese stock market. Its current P/E of 6,8x is 63% below its own 7-year average (18,6x), suggesting the stock is trading cheaper than its historical norm. P/B stands at 1x, 10% above its multi-year average of 0,9x. Return on equity (ROE) is at 11,3%. Its debt-to-equity ratio of 0,1x is low, reflecting a conservative capital structure. In 2025, revenue grew 104% year-on-year while after-tax profit grew 55%.
